| Career Roles | Key Responsibilities |
|---|---|
| Brand Manager | Develop and implement brand strategies, manage brand communication, and ensure brand consistency. |
| Marketing Specialist | Create marketing campaigns, analyze market trends, and collaborate with internal teams. |
| Public Relations Coordinator | Manage media relations, create press releases, and coordinate PR events. |
| Social Media Manager | Develop social media strategies, create engaging content, and monitor online presence. |
| Content Creator | Produce creative and compelling content for various platforms, including websites and blogs. |
